{"id":16558909,"url":"https://github.com/yeregorix/mirage","last_synced_at":"2025-07-23T01:32:14.313Z","repository":{"id":131169995,"uuid":"129366454","full_name":"Yeregorix/Mirage","owner":"Yeregorix","description":"The best solution against xray users","archived":false,"fork":false,"pushed_at":"2025-07-07T09:05:45.000Z","size":822,"stargazers_count":19,"open_issues_count":0,"forks_count":1,"subscribers_count":5,"default_branch":"master","last_synced_at":"2025-07-07T10:24:54.452Z","etag":null,"topics":["anticheat","antixray","java","minecraft","plugin","sponge","xray"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Yeregorix.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null,"zenodo":null}},"created_at":"2018-04-13T07:35:59.000Z","updated_at":"2025-07-07T09:05:49.000Z","dependencies_parsed_at":"2024-04-23T20:58:40.576Z","dependency_job_id":"6e7349d4-f89b-42b4-88c8-8a26889371a4","html_url":"https://github.com/Yeregorix/Mirage","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/Yeregorix/Mirage","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Yeregorix%2FMirage","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Yeregorix%2FMirage/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Yeregorix%2FMirage/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Yeregorix%2FMirage/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Yeregorix","download_url":"https://codeload.github.com/Yeregorix/Mirage/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Yeregorix%2FMirage/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":266602749,"owners_count":23954694,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","status":"online","status_checked_at":"2025-07-22T02:00:09.085Z","response_time":66,"last_error":null,"robots_txt_status":null,"robots_txt_updated_at":null,"robots_txt_url":"https://github.com/robots.txt","online":true,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["anticheat","antixray","java","minecraft","plugin","sponge","xray"],"created_at":"2024-10-11T20:24:06.379Z","updated_at":"2025-07-23T01:32:14.288Z","avatar_url":"https://github.com/Yeregorix.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Mirage\n\nMirage is a Minecraft plugin that protects your server against xray mods and packs.\n\n![alt text](https://files.smoofyuniverse.net/images/mirage_screenshots.png)\n\n## Server owners\n\nCompiled artifacts and additional information can be found on Ore: https://ore.spongepowered.org/Yeregorix/Mirage.\n\n## Developers\n\nMirage requires Java 21 to build.\n\nCommands:\n\n- `./gradlew shadowJar` constructs a jar that includes all its dependencies.\n- `./gradlew setupVanillaServer` setups a vanilla server in directory `run/vanilla`.\n- `./gradlew setupForgeServer` setups a Forge server in directory `run/forge`.\n\n## Known issues\n\n### Incompatibility with elytradev's mod\n\nThe Mirage plugin distributed on Ore and the elytradev's mod share the same identifier.\nThis causes a crash on server startup with the following error\nmessage: `java.lang.NoClassDefFoundError: com/elytradev/mirage/event/GatherLightsEvent`.\n\nTo fix this, please use the Mirage plugin jar hosted at https://files.smoofyuniverse.net/smoofymirage/.\n\nMirage version 1.5.0 and above should not be affected by this issue, because elytradev's mod has not been updated past\nMinecraft 1.12.2.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fyeregorix%2Fmirage","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fyeregorix%2Fmirage","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fyeregorix%2Fmirage/lists"}